DEMONOLOGY.

NIGHT-DREAMS trace on Memory's wall Shadows of the thoughts of day,

And thy fortunes as they fall

The bias of thy will betray.

In the chamber, on the stairs,

Lurking dumb,

Go and come

Lemurs and Lars.

DEMONOLOGY.1

THE name Demonology covers dreams, omens, coincidences, luck, sortilege, magic, and other experiences which shun rather than court inquiry, and deserve notice chiefly because every man has usually in a lifetime two or three hints in this kind which are specially impressive to him. They also shed light on our structure.

The witchcraft of sleep divides with truth the empire of our lives. This soft enchantress visits two children lying locked in each other's arms, and carries them asunder by wide spaces of land and sea, and wide intervals of time:

"There lies a sleeping city, God of dreams!
What an unreal and fantastic world

Is going on below!

Within the sweep of yon encircling wall

How many a large creation of the night,

Wide wilderness and mountain, rock and sea,

Peopled with busy, transitory groups,

Finds room to rise, and never feels the crowd."
